Attitudes and perspectives of midwifery students towards distance edu-cation during the COVID-19 pandemic

Abstract :Objective: This study aims to determine the attitudes and perspectives of midwifery students towards distance education during the COVID-19 pandemic. Methods: The universe of the study consists of undergraduate students who continue to study in mid-wifery departments in Turkey. The study universe consisted of 488 midwifery students enrolled in uni-versity midwifery programs. Midwifery students were invited to participate in the study with a conven-ience sampling method through WhatsApp groups and social media accounts. The data were collected with an introductory questionnaire containing socio-demographic information prepared by the research-ers and the Attitude Scale towards Distance Education. Results: It was determined that the mean age of the students participating in the study was 21.86±9.29 years; 15% were first grade, 20.5% were second grade, 35% were third grade, and 29.1% were fourth grade. The mean score of the students on the scale was determined as 90.44±26.58. There was a signifi-cant difference between the scale scores and the region of the student\\\'s school and the classes they stud-ied. It has been observed that the scale scores of the students living in the Central and Eastern Anatolia regions and the second and third-year students are low. Conclusion: It can be said that the midwifery department students\\\' attitudes towards distance education in the first period of the distance education process, which started with a break from face-to-face educa-tion after the pandemic, are at a moderate level of positivity.Keywords : COVID-19 Pandemisi, Uzaktan Eğitim, Öğrenciler, Ebelik
